Ogawa","doi":"10.1109/SICE.1999.788682","DOIUrl":"https://doi.org/10.1109/SICE.1999.788682","url":null,"abstract":"A food tray carrying robot with a three-dimensional drive system and a man-machine interface is proposed. No electrical power is required to maintain the horizontal position of a food tray since a parallel link mechanism is used in the radial direction drive mechanism. The three-dimensional man-machine interface using strain gages is set under the food tray. A patient needs only small finger force to move the food tray because of the use of the three-dimensional man-machine interface. Choi","doi":"10.1109/SICE.1999.788712","DOIUrl":"https://doi.org/10.1109/SICE.1999.788712","url":null,"abstract":"This work is concerned with the decoupling and tracking control for linear time-varying systems such as missiles, rockets, fighters, etc. Despite its well-known limitations, gain-scheduling control appeared to be focus of the research efforts. Scheduling of frozen-time, frozen-state controller for fast time-varying dynamics is known to be mathematically fallacious, and practically hazardous. Therefore, recent research efforts are being directed towards applying time-varying controllers. In this paper, i) we introduce a differential algebraic eigenvalue theory for linear time-varying systems, and ii) a novel decoupling and tracking control scheme is proposed by using the PD-eigenstructure assignment scheme via differential Sylvester equation and CGT (command generator tracker) for linear time-varying systems. Hirakawa","doi":"10.1109/SICE.1999.788593","DOIUrl":"https://doi.org/10.1109/SICE.1999.788593","url":null,"abstract":"A probe microphone has a thin, empty and long probe tube. Therefore, frequency characteristics of a probe microphone are not good. In this paper, we analyze a probe microphone constructed by a probe, a spacer and a regular microphone. In this microphone, the sound wave is attenuated by viscosity of air. So, sound solution is given with the attenuation constant /spl delta/ and the phase constant K. As a result, frequency characteristics of a probe microphone were obtained for the size of the probe tube, /spl delta/ and K. In the experiment, applying a white noise or a rectangular signal to the speaker,sound from the probe microphone was compared with that of the regular microphone. Experimental results agreed well with the theoretical ones.","PeriodicalId":103164,"journal":{"name":"SICE '99. Proceedings of the 38th SICE Annual Conference. International Session Papers (IEEE Cat.
